What type of projects will interns work on during the internship?
Interns will assist in the coordination, analysis, and development of planning documents and materials for a variety of project types within the Planning + Design Department.
What academic qualifications are required for the internship?
Candidates must be currently pursuing a Bachelor's or Master's degree from an accredited program in City/Community/Regional Planning or a related field.
What software skills are preferred for this internship position?
Experience with GIS, Adobe Creative Suite, Microsoft Office, and AutoCAD is preferred for this role.
What kind of research will interns be expected to conduct?
Interns will conduct research on zoning regulations, land use policies, and planning codes to inform project decisions and ensure compliance with local, regional, and state regulations.
What are the working conditions for this internship?
The internship will primarily be in an office setting with limited exposure to adverse environmental conditions, and physical tasks may include lifting up to 30 pounds occasionally.
